An exciting opportunity exists to join the Radiology Department at Wollongong Hospital.
Wollongong Hospital is the Illawarra and Shoalhaven’s major referral and teaching hospital and has a bed base of more than 500. The campus, which incorporates the Illawarra Regional Cancer Care Centre, provides a comprehensive range of inpatient, outpatient and community-based services.
What you'll be doing
The successful appointee will perform several roles under supervision: general radiology diagnostic reporting duties relevant to the level of prior training and capability of the trainee, contribute to quality and safety functions in Medical Imaging, contribute to the ISLHD Choosing Wisely program and M&M Meetings, and assist in the clinical assessment, scheduling and triage of patients who are to undergo or have had interventional procedures. The Unaccredited Trainee will have the opportunity to perform, under supervision, some of the roles of radiology trainees in accredited training positions, subject to the level of prior experience and capability. Where possible, this will include an introduction to Tier A interventional procedures. There will be exposure to all modalities (x-ray, CT, ultrasound and MRI). The position will be located principally at Wollongong Hospital with occasional time at Shellharbour Hospital and Shoalhaven Hospital under direct radiologist supervision.
The position is most suited to a medical trainee who is planning a career in medical imaging and is seeking the skills and experience required to apply for an accredited Radiology Trainee Network Position in the following year.

Selection Criteria
- MBBS or equivalent, current general registration with the Medical Board of Australia.
- At least three years' post graduate experience in public hospital service (or equivalent)
- Demonstrated interest in Radiology and evidence of preparation for RANZCR Radiology training and preferably some prior experience in Radiology or related areas e.g. Nuclear Medicine.
- Demonstrated ability to work independently within a complex health care setting with proven time management and problem solving skills.
- Ability to perform data analysis and interpretations relevant to medical imaging referrals and activity.
- Excellent written, verbal and multimedia communication skills, in order to interact effectively with patients, referrers, colleagues and other team members.
- Excellent academic record commensurate with experience, evidence of ongoing learning, teaching activities, potential involvement with projects and research publications.
- Understanding quality improvement principles and methodology, and ability to review and analyse incidents.
